A man has some amount of money and he invested the money in two schemes X and Y in the ratio of 2 : 5 for 2 years, scheme X offers 30% pa compound interest and scheme Y offers 15% pa Simple interest. The difference between the interest earned from both the schemes is Rs. 21600. Find the amount invested in scheme Y.

A.

9,00,000

B.

10,00,000

C.

8,00,000

D.

7,00,000

E.

11,00,000

Correct option is A

Let the amount invested in X & Y be 200a & 500a respectively.
Equivalent rate of CI for 2 years at 30% p.a. =(30+30+30×30100)%=69%(30 + 30 + \frac{30 \times 30}{100})\% = 69\%
Interest received from scheme X =69100\frac{69}{100}​×200a=138a

Interest received from scheme Y =500a×15×2100\frac{500a \times 15 \times 2}{100}​=150a
ATQ,
150a – 138a = 21600
12a=21600
a = 1800
Amount invested in scheme Y = 500a = 500×1800=9,00,000 Rs
